Lakes Entrance Aboriginal Health Association

Djillay Ngalu

Lakes Entrance Aboriginal Health Association is the Aboriginal community controlled health organisation in Lakes Entrance.Its vision is to improve the health and wellbeing of Aboriginal people in the communities in and around Lakes Entrance, Lake Tyers Beach, Lake Bunga, Swan Reach, Tambo Upper and Metung.The association offers holistic and culturally appropriate services including medical transport, local justice worker program, Koori youth justice program, Elders planned activity group, health promotion and chronic care program, including ante and post natal care for pregnant women, and a health program specifically designed for Aboriginal men.
